    "Misery" is a song by American singer-songwriter P!nk, taken from her sophomore studio album, M!ssundaztood. It features vocals from Aerosmith frontman Steven Tyler.

    On initial pressings of M!ssundaztood, P!nk sang all the verses, including the one that Tyler sings on current pressings of the album. On current pressings of M!ssundaztood, Steven Tyler sings an entire verse as opposed to a providing only few lines and background vocals. The first version of the album that contains the version of "Misery" where P!nk sings Tyler's verse was not on a specific pressing run, as even some copies of the first version of the album released (with the enhanced content) have the current version of the song. It is somewhat hard to find editions of the album with the original version of the song.

  6. Nov 20, 2001 · Missundaztood (styled as M!ssundaztood) is the second studio album by American singer-songwriter P!nk. The album was released worldwide in late 2001 to global commercial and critical success, critics welcoming the new pop-rock sound P!nk presented on the record, after an urban-influenced debut.
